The formula for one formula unit of the compound between NO2 and Be will be Be(NO2)2. Beryllium forms a +2 cation and nitrite (NO2-) is a polyatomic ion with a -1 charge, so two nitrite ions are needed to balance the charge of one beryllium ion in the compound.

The empirical formula for a compound represents the simplest whole number ratio of atoms present in a molecule. For the molecular formula N2O4, the empirical formula is NO2 because it shows the simplest ratio of nitrogen and oxygen atoms present in the compound.

The compound with the formula NO2 is called nitrogen dioxide. It is a reddish-brown gas at room temperature and is an important air pollutant due to its role in forming smog and contributing to respiratory issues.
